Radeke Back with Aeros

Published on May 15, 2012 under Eastern League (EL1)
Akron RubberDucks News Release


AKRON, OH - The Cleveland Indians announced Tuesday that righthander Mason Radeke has been promoted to the Akron Aeros from the Lake County Captains.

This is Radeke's second call-up to the Aeros this season. He made two appearances, including one start, for the Aeros in early May, going 1-1, with no ERA.

Radeke, 21, is 2-1, 3.79 ERA for the Captains this year. He has worked eight games, all in relief, striking out 20 hitters in 19 innings, while issuing only four walks. A second-year pro, Radeke began his professional career last season at Mahoning Valley, going 2-0, 4.53, in nine starts.

Radeke was drafted by the Indians in the 35th round last summer. He played college baseball at Cal Poly-San Luis Obispo. As a junior for the Mustangs, he was 8-4, 3.07, and ranked second in the Big West Conference in strikeouts with 95.

The Aeros roster now stands at 24 players.
